Abstract

A terminal apparatus () according to an embodiment of the present disclosure includes a data processing unit () and a wireless signal processing unit (). The data processing unit () generates a first frame including a requirement related to a latency during data communication and inquiring a base station () whether communication that satisfies the requirement is possible. The wireless signal processing unit () transmits the first frame.
